ABOUT

YG Entertainment's globally dominant quartet debuted in 2016 and became the first K-pop girl group to headline Coachella in 2023. Their Deadline World Tour in 2025 confirmed their status as the highest-grossing girl group in live concert history, with each member holding a separate luxury fashion house ambassadorship.

THE MEMBERS

Jisoo

Jisoo

Seoul, South Korea

Kim Ji-soo was scouted by YG Entertainment in 2011 while still in high school. She trained for five years — among the longest training periods of any BLACKPINK member — before debuting as the group's eldest member and visual at 21. Beyond music, Jisoo pursued acting and starred as the lead in the Korean drama Snowdrop in 2021, earning her the title of BLACKPINK's most prominent multi-hyphenate. She launched her solo career in 2023 with the single 'Flower', which debuted at number one on Korea's Circle Chart.

Jennie

Jennie

Seoul, South Korea (schooled in New Zealand)

Jennie Kim spent her formative school years in New Zealand, which gave her native-level English fluency and a Western pop perspective that distinguishes her within BLACKPINK. She became a YG trainee in 2010 at age 14, training for six years before debut. BLACKPINK's only rapper-vocalist hybrid, she debuted her solo career with 'SOLO' in 2018 — it reached number one in Korea and charted in 26 countries. She is a Chanel global ambassador and one of the most photographed women in contemporary fashion.

Rosé

Rosé

Auckland, New Zealand (raised in Melbourne, Australia)

Park Chaeyoung was self-taught on guitar and singing in church choirs in Melbourne before being discovered at a YG Australia open audition in 2012. She moved alone to Seoul at 15, not yet fluent in Korean, and trained for four years. Her distinctive voice — bright and airy in its upper register, raw and emotional at full volume — became BLACKPINK's sonic signature. Her solo album 'rosie' (2024) and the Bruno Mars collaboration 'APT.' made her the first BLACKPINK member to achieve a major Western pop crossover.

Lisa

Lisa

Buriram, Thailand

Lalisa Manoban grew up in Buriram, a small city in northeastern Thailand, and began dancing seriously at age four. At 14, she entered a YG Entertainment open audition in Thailand and was the only candidate — out of approximately 4,000 — to be accepted. She moved to Seoul without speaking Korean and became the first non-Korean BLACKPINK member. Her solo debut 'LALISA' (2021) broke YouTube records, amassing over 73 million views in 24 hours, and she has since built one of K-pop's most visible solo careers.
